Want to clean up your storage, but have no idea where to even start? It's simple and psychologically effective and assumes you're already in a root shell of your terminal:
cd /data/
du -ma . -d 100 |sort -n

No, -d doesn't stand for deletion of your files, it's depth. You'll get a relatively quickly generated list of largest directories and files sorted by size in less than 20 seconds unless you check on a desktop with HDD.

You don't have to ask engineers, you don't have to ask nerds. Ask any global shutter camera owner if they're exempt from motion blur.
Rolling shutter causes a movement distortion and motion blur is ironically capable of hiding it. Global shutter would be the natural next step after solving dynamic range. But will single frame quality be good enough to alleviate the concern of noise increase the global shutter sensors are known from? Time will tell.
